Normal Fairy Tales worksheets activities present a unique blend of education and entertainment, making them an essential tool in a child’s learning journey. These activities are not just about reading and listening to enchanting stories; they are designed to stimulate critical thinking, enhance literacy skills, and ignite a creative spark in young minds. Let’s delve into why these worksheets are so beneficial.
Firstly, Normal Fairy Tales worksheets activities are instrumental in developing language and literacy skills. Through engaging with the characters and plots of fairy tales, children learn new vocabulary, understand sentence structure, and grasp the elements of storytelling. This enriches their language development and sets a strong foundation for their reading and writing abilities.
Moreover, these activities encourage critical thinking and comprehension. As children analyze the morals and themes within these stories, they learn to interpret meanings, draw conclusions, and compare and contrast different tales. This not only enhances their cognitive skills but also teaches them valuable life lessons about good and evil, right and wrong, and the consequences of one's actions.
Creativity and imagination soar when children immerse themselves in the magical worlds of fairy tales. Normal Fairy Tales worksheets activities often include prompts for drawing, writing their own stories, or imagining alternative endings. This not only bolsters their creative skills but also promotes innovative thinking, a trait that is invaluable in every aspect of life.
Furthermore, these worksheets provide an excellent opportunity for cultural education. Fairy tales from around the world give children a glimpse into diverse cultures, traditions, and values, fostering a sense of global awareness and empathy.
In conclusion, Normal Fairy Tales worksheets activities are a captivating blend of education, creativity, and cultural exploration. They play a crucial role in developing a child’s language and literacy skills, critical thinking, creativity, and understanding of the world. Engaging with these timeless tales through structured activities ensures that learning is both effective and enjoyable.
